The Hohenlind Oak
age unknownPedunculate Oak
A hundred metres from the big plane in the Hohenlind hospital park stands a pedunculate oak, 3.75 metres round, on the same patch of former estate ground that predates the hospital by the better part of a century. The two trees make one short walk rather than two separate trips, both listed as natural monuments in Cologne's own designation register and both measured by the city on the same day in May 2018. The oak has no recorded age of its own, but the estate around it was already reckoned about 150 years old in a 1932 account, which puts at least some of its planting into the late 1700s, a fact about the park rather than a dated certificate for this particular trunk. A third registered tree, a second plane, stands nearby too, though without a published girth or coordinate to go with it, which is why it stays a lead rather than a fourth stop on this walk. The park belongs to St. Elisabeth-Krankenhaus, a hospital, and both the hospital and independent sources confirm the grounds stay open to the public in daytime hours. The building is not part of the visit; the trees around it are.

- Species
- Pedunculate Oak (Quercus robur)
- Age estimate
- Location
- Park of St. Elisabeth-Krankenhaus Koln-Hohenlind, Werthmannstrasse 1-3, 50935 Koln (Lindenthal)
- Access
- Free, open to the public during daytime hours. Part of the same estate park as kol_002, roughly 100 m away on foot.
- Getting there
- Koln-Lindenthal. Bus stop 'Werthmannstrasse' on Duererner Strasse (KVB line 136), then a short walk into the park.
